Searching for WIMP Dark Matter: The case for Germanium Ionization Detectors
Abstract
Description
An overview of the main strategies followed in the search for non-baryonic particle dark matter in the form of WIMPs is given. To illustrate these searches the case for Germanium ionization detectors is selected.
Invited talk given at the 29th International Meeting on Fundamental Physics, Sitges (Barcelona), Feb. 2001, to be published in the Proceedings
